Muted economic confidence across the globe hasn’t put a lid on the cash some will spend on sought-after footwear.
It’s been a rough year for consumer spending, but shoppers are still trawling eBay listings on the hunt for sneakers worth hundreds of dollars.
Ebay Australia’s head of sneaker and collectibles, Alaister Low, said the rise of social media has helped power demand for exclusive footwear in Australia and overseas. And while shoppers might be reining in their spending in a range of discretionary categories, when it comes to the purchases most important to them, they’re not holding back.
The two months leading up to Christmas are make or break for Australia’s retail sector, but this year brands are faced with a consumer psyche they may not have ever seen before.On the one hand, customers are starting their festive shopping bruised by the past year of surging grocery prices and growing mortgage payments – and theOn the other, they’re clearly splashing cash in certain areas, whether that’s high-end sneakers or on celebrations and social connection with family and friends.
